EDI2GG41864V  
576 Kilobyte Synchronous Card Edge DIMM  
FEATURES  
4x64Kx18 Synchronous  
Flow-Through Architecture  
The EDI2KG41864VxxD2 is a Synchronous SRAM, 60 position  
Card Edge DIMM (120 contacts) Module, organized as 4x64Kx18.  
The Module contains four (4) Synchronous Burst Ram Devices,  
packaged in the industry standard JEDEC 14mmx20mm TQFP  
placed on a Multilayer FR4 Substrate. The module architecture is  
defined as a Synchronous Only, Flow-Through, Early Write device.  
This module provides high performance, ultra fast access times at a  
cost per bit benefit over BiCMOS Asynchronous SRAM based  
devices. As well as improved cost per bit, the use of Synchronous  
or Synchronous Burst devices or modules can ease the memory  
subsystem design by reducing or easing the memory controller  
requirement.

Synchronous operations are in relation to an externally supplied clock,  
registered address, registered global write, registered enables as well  
as an Asynchronous Output enable. All read and Write operations to  
this module are performed on Long Words (Double Words) 32 bit  
operation.  
High Capacitance (30pf) drive, at rated Access  
Speed  
Single total array Clock  
Multiple Vcc and Gnd  
Write cycles are internally self timed and are initiated by a rising clock  
edge. This feature relieves the designer the task of developing external  
write pulse width circuitry.
